How they compare
Kazakhstan currently reports 97.87 kilowatt-hours against 86.1 kilowatt-hours in Colombia, a difference of 11.77 kilowatt-hours.
That makes Kazakhstan's figure about 1.1 times Colombia's.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 36 shared years of data; in 1990 it was Kazakhstan ahead.
Colombia ranks 96th and Kazakhstan ranks 93rd of 210 countries.
Across the 4 decades both report, Colombia averaged higher in 1 and Kazakhstan in 2.
